An Oban woman had nearly seven times the legal amount of alcohol in her system when police stopped her car, Oban Sheriff Court has heard.
Ann Marie Birnie, 48, of 10 West Bay Flats, admitted the offence, which took place on October 29 last year. Procurator fiscal Eoin McGinty told the court last week that police were acting on an anonymous tip-off.
Her breath test measured 149 micrograms per 100 millilitres of breath; the legal limit is 22. Her defence agent Kevin McGinness told the court of ‘the very difficult personal circumstances’ Birnie had to deal with following the break-up of her marriage.
